Green series digi grade AES/EBU 110 Ohm UPOFC cable
Van Damme Green series has been specifically designed for the accurate transmission
of digital audio signals. Great attention has been paid to the electrical
characteristics and conductor capacitance to ensure that signals remain error
free even over long distances. In addition the low capacitance of this range
makes Green series particularly suitable for other data signals such as RS422,
RS485, DMX, Midi and timecode. It is also suitable for analogue balanced
audio.
Van Damme now use a higher purity oxygen free copper for the conductors
- Ultra Pure Oxygen Free Copper. The use of this material further improves
the ‘solderability’ and conductivity of the conductor resulting in faithful
and transparent signal reproduction.
Foam skin polyolefin is used for the conductor insulation. This special insulation
is made up of individual pockets of inert gas suspended in polyolefin, resulting
in a low dielectric constant (2.3) and most importantly low capacitance.
The skin refers to the outer layer of the insulation, which forms during
the extrusion process. This skin is harder than the layer of insulation below
it ensuring that the conductor is well protected. The dielectric constant
of foam skin polyolefin remains stable over a wide frequency range, essential
for transmission of digital signals. Other relevant properties include good
stress and temperature resistance.
For the one pair and multicores, pairs are twisted together with a tinned UPOFC drain wire and shielded with an aluminium/polyester foil screen. The 150% coverage method employed ensures that the pair is fully screened and that the drain wire remains in close contact with the conductive aluminium foil allowing interference to be effectively taken to ground.
The individual pairs, mulitcore and AES microphone cable are all oversheathed with the same soft abrasion resistant PVC composite jacket.
